Link required for free use.
Subscription needed for commercial purposes.
An intricate illustration of a squirrel in a mystical forest setting. The squirrel is surrounded by intertwining tree branches and lush foliage, enhancing the sense of serenity and nature. The attention to detail in the fur and eyes brings the creature to life, creating an enchanting and immersive experience.
Image details
File type PNG
Size 7392×5568
Published 20:44
Comments about Squirrel in Enchanted Forest Artwork